SpaceX is targeting Thursday, April 27 at 6:40 a.m. PT (13:40 UTC) for a Falcon 9 launch of 46 Starlink satellites to low-Earth orbit from Space Launch Complex 4 East (SLC-4E) at Vandenberg Space Force Base in California. The first stage booster supporting this mission previously launched Crew-1, Crew-2, SXM-8, CRS-23, IXPE, Transporter-4, Transporter-5, Globalstar FM15, ISI EROS C-3, and three Starlink missions. Following stage separation, Falcon 9’s first stage will land on the Of Course I Still Love You droneship stationed in the Pacific Ocean.

Timeline

All Times Are Approximate

Countdown

  • T-00:38:00

    SpaceX Launch Director verifies go for propellant load

  • T-00:35:00

    RP-1 (rocket grade kerosene) loading begins

  • T-00:35:00

    1st stage LOX (liquid oxygen) loading begins

  • T-00:16:00

    2nd stage LOX loading begins

  • T-00:07:00

    Falcon 9 begins engine chill prior to launch

  • T-00:01:00

    Command flight computer to begin final prelaunch checks

  • T-00:01:00

    Propellant tank pressurization to flight pressure begins

  • T-00:00:45

    SpaceX Launch Director verifies go for launch

  • T-00:00:03

    Engine controller commands engine ignition sequence to start

  • T+00:00:00

    Falcon 9 liftoff

Launch, Landing, and Deployment

  • T+00:01:12

    Max Q (moment of peak mechanical stress on the rocket)

  • T+00:02:27

    1st stage main engine cutoff (MECO)

  • T+00:02:30

    1st and 2nd stages separate

  • T+00:02:36

    2nd stage engine starts (SES-1)

  • T+00:02:47

    Fairing deployment

  • T+00:06:13

    1st stage entry burn begins

  • T+00:06:32

    1st stage entry burn ends

  • T+00:08:01

    1st stage landing burn begins

  • T+00:08:24

    1st stage landing

  • T+00:08:38

    2nd stage engine cutoff (SECO-1)

  • T+00:52:44

    2nd stage engine starts (SES-2)

  • T+00:52:46

    2nd stage engine cutoff (SECO-2)

  • T+00:59:53

    Starlink satellites deploy
